The Music Man Project offers award winning music education and performance services for people with learning disabilities. In Essex, they now run classes 6 days a week, including daily sessions for adults, the continuation of the original Saturday music school plus curriculum and enrichment services for local special schools.

If you have never done a Ceilidh before, it is fun, social dance where the moves are taught beforehand and then called out during the dance. You don’t have to be a ‘dancer’ to join in! It’s a good laugh, and no-one minds if you get it all right. You dance it in pairs, and in groups, but you don’t need a partner to come along as people switch around who they dance with between dances.
We’ll be having an hour of Ceilidh, followed by a half-hour break with buffet food, and then another hour of dancing after that. You can choose to dance every dance, or sit out as many as you like.
